Step-by-Step Preparation of Keto Protein Pancakes

If you’ve been exploring options for a keto lifestyle, you know how valuable a good breakfast can be. Enter Keto Protein Pancakes, your new best friend! Not only are they delicious, but they also keep you in line with your dietary preferences. Let’s dive into the step-by-step preparation of these tasty, fluffy wonders that will fuel your day.

Gather your ingredients

Before we get cooking, let’s ensure you have everything you need. Here’s what you’ll require for four servings of Keto Protein Pancakes:

  • 1 cup almond flour – low in carbs and a great source of healthy fats
  • 1/4 cup protein powder – choose your favorite; whey or plant-based both work wonders
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der – to give those pancakes nice lift
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t – enhances the flavors
  • 3 large eggs – bind everything together and add protein
  • 1/2 cup unsweetened almond milk – adjust the consistency as needed
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ract – for that warm, sweet flavor
  • Coconut oil or butter – for cooking, and adds richness

Make sure to get high-quality ingredients; they really make a difference in the final product.

Blend dry ingredients

Now that you have your ingredients, let’s move on to the dry mix. In a large mixing bowl, combine:

  • Almond flour
  • Protein powder
  • Baking powder
  • Salt

Using a whisk or a fork, mix these together until they’re well-combined. This is a straightforward step, but don’t skip it—properly mixing your dry ingredients prevents clumping and ensures even distribution. You want each pancake to have the perfect balance of flavors!

Mix wet ingredients

In a separate bowl, it’s time to combine your wet ingredients. This part is fun! You’ll need to crack the eggs, add the almond milk, and pour in the vanilla extract. Whisk these ingredients together until the mixture is smooth. Don’t be shy with your whisking; you want all the elements to come together seamlessly, creating a velvety blend that’ll make your pancakes extra fluffy.

While whisking, it can be handy to think about how flavorful your pancakes will be. Imagine enjoying them topped with berries or slathered in sugar-free syrup. Sounds tempting, right?

Combine wet and dry ingredients

Now comes the moment you’ve been waiting for: bringing it all together! Gently pour the wet mixture into the bowl of dry ingredients. Using a spatula, fold the two mixtures until they’re just combined. It’s important not to over-mix; a few lumps are perfectly fine. Overworking the batter can lead to denser pancakes, and we’re aiming for light and fluffy.

If the batter seems too thick, you can add a tad more almond milk until you reach your desired consistency. Keep in mind that a slightly thicker batter makes for more substantial pancakes, while a thinner version gives you a lighter outcome.

Cook the pancakes

It’s time to hit the stovetop! Preheat a non-stick skillet over medium heat and add a small amount of coconut oil or butter. Once hot, ladle approximately 1/4 cup of batter onto the skillet for each pancake. Allow them to cook until you see bubbles forming on the surface, indicating it’s time to flip—about 2-3 minutes.

Once flipped, cook for another 1-2 minutes until golden brown. The kitchen should be smelling heavenly. Transfer them to a plate and repeat the process until all the batter is used.

Serve your delicious Keto Protein Pancakes with some turkey bacon or chicken ham for a complete meal. Enjoy every bite knowing it’s crafted with your health goals in mind!

By taking these simple steps, you’ll have a stack of Keto Protein Pancakes that not only satisfies your cravings but also aligns with your health-focused lifestyle. Happy cooking!

Cooking Tips and Notes for Keto Protein Pancakes

Choosing the Right Protein Powder

When it comes to making Keto Protein Pancakes, the choice of protein powder can significantly affect the flavor and texture. Opt for a low-carb option like whey or pea protein—it blends well and keeps your pancakes fluffy. If you’re unsure, check out reviews on brands like Optimum Nutrition or Quest Protein. They offer great flavor without unnecessary sugars or fillers.

Tips for Flipping Pancakes

Flipping can be tricky, but with a few simple tips, you’ll pancake like a pro!

  • Let them bubble: Wait for bubbles to form around the edges before you flip. This indicates that they’re ready.
  • Use a non-stick skillet: Ensure your pan is well-greased with coconut oil or butter to avoid sticking—nobody enjoys a torn pancake!
  • Flip with care: Use a thin spatula and gently slide it under the pancake; a quick flick of the wrist makes the flip easy.

FAQs about Keto Protein Pancakes

Can I make these pancakes without protein powder?

Absolutely! If you’re not a fan of protein powder or want to skip it, you can substitute it with almond flour or coconut flour. Keep in mind that this might change the texture slightly, but you’ll still get delicious keto protein pancakes. The key is to ensure you maintain the right consistency, so a bit of experimentation can guide you to the perfect batter.

What are the best toppings for keto pancakes?

Toppings can elevate your keto protein pancakes from tasty to extraordinary! Here are some fantastic options:

  • Sugar-Free Syrup: Look for syrups sweetened with erythritol or stevia.
  • Fresh Berries: Raspberries, blueberries, or strawberries add a refreshing touch while keeping carbs low.
  • Unsweetened Nut Butter: Almond or peanut butter can add healthy fats and flavor.
  • Whipped Cream: Opt for a sugar-free version for a delightful texture.
  • Coconut Flakes: Unsweetened coconut adds a nice crunch while being keto-friendly.

Mix and match these toppings for a customizable breakfast every day!

How do I store leftover pancakes?

Storing your pancakes is a breeze! Just let them cool completely, then stack them with a piece of parchment paper between each pancake to prevent sticking. Store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days or freeze them for up to a month. When you’re ready to enjoy, simply reheat them in the microwave or toaster. No fuss, and you can savor that keto delight anytime!

Keto Protein Pancakes: The Best Ultimate Recipe for 4 with Turkey Bacon

Make delicious keto protein pancakes with turkey bacon for a healthy breakfast that satisfies.

  • Author: Souzan
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Category: Breakfast
  • Method: Skillet
  • Cuisine: American
  • Diet: Keto

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up almond flour
  • 1/4 cup protein powder
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up unsweetened almond milk
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 4 slices turkey bacon

Instructions

  1. In a bowl, mix almond flour, protein powder, baking powder, and vanilla extract.
  2. Add eggs and almond milk, whisk until smooth.
  3. Heat a skillet over medium heat and pour batter to form pancakes.
  4. Cook until bubbles form, then flip and cook until golden brown.
  5. In a separate pan, cook turkey bacon until crispy.
  6. Serve pancakes topped with turkey bacon.

Notes

  • Ensure the skillet is well-greased to prevent sticking.
  • Adjust the thickness of the batter with more almond milk if needed.

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 pancake
  • Calories: 150
  • Sugar: 2g
  • Sodium: 200mg
  • Fat: 10g
  • Saturated Fat: 1g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 8g
  • Trans Fat: 0g
  • Carbohydrates: 5g
  • Fiber: 3g
  • Protein: 12g
  • Cholesterol: 80mg
